Early Life

Joe Cobb was born on July 11, 1916, in Shawnee, Oklahoma. From a young age, he showed an interest in performing. At the age of five, in 1921, he auditioned for the Our Gang comedy series, a decision that would launch his acting career.

Our Gang Career

Joe Cobb became a household name for his role as the original "fat boy" in the Our Gang comedies, which he portrayed from 1922 to 1929. His comedic timing and charm made him a fan favorite among audiences.

His final film as a regular cast member was on the episode Boxing Gloves in 1929. Although his time in Our Gang came to an end, his impact on the series was undeniable.

Post-Acting Career

After his acting career, Joe Cobb took on a different path. He worked as an assembler for North American Aviation, showcasing his versatility and adaptability outside of the entertainment industry.
